Plastic injection molding:
⪠Process cycle:
The process cycle for injection molding is very short, typically between 2 seconds and 2 minutes, and consists of the following four stages
1) Clamping - Prior to the injection of the material into the mold, the two halves of the mold must first be securely closed by the clamping unit
2) Injection - The raw plastic material, usually in the form of pellets, is fed into the injection molding machine, and advanced towards the mold by the injection unit
3) Cooling - The molten plastic that is inside the mold begins to cool as soon as it makes with the interior mold surfaces
4) Ejection - After sufficient time has passed, the cooled part may be ejected from the mold by the ejection system, which is attached to the rear half of the mold.

Insert Molding:The most widely used process is insert molding, where a pre-molded insert is placed into a mold and the TPE is shot directly over it
Multiple Material Molding: Multiple material, also known as two-shot (or multi-shot), molding requires a special injection molding machine that is equipped with two or more barrels, allowing two (or more) materials to be shot into the same mold during the same molding cycle
